Presentation Title Research on the Flow Field of 550mm×700mm Rectangular Bloom Mold by SEN Parameters
Author(s) Haitao Ma, Weiqiang Chen, Xueqian Cao, Jie Chen, Yanhui Sun
On-Site Speaker (Planned) Haitao Ma
Abstract Scope Abstract: The influence of the submerged entry nozzle(SEN) on the flow field and heat transfer of the 550mm×700mm super-large cross-section rectangular bloom mold was studied by using the ANSYS Fluent finite element software. The research results showed that the adoption of the double-hole type SEN was more conducive to the upward floating of inclusions and was less likely to cause slag entrapping on the liquid surface. When the inclination angle of the side hole was 60°, the flow velocity at the meniscus was 0m/s, which was less likely to cause slag entrapment, and was more conducive to the upward floating of inclusions. As the insertion depth of the SEN increased, the probability of slag entrapment on the liquid surface was reduced, but the chance of inclusions floating up was also decreased. Taking all factors into account, the insertion depth of the SEN was preferably 300mm.
